Laboratory Testing and Blood Analysis

As P Shot Treatment involves using platelet-rich plasma derived from your blood, pre-treatment lab testing plays a critical role. The doctor will typically request a complete blood panel to evaluate:

  • Platelet levels and quality.

  • Red and white blood cell counts.

  • Any potential markers of infection or inflammation.

This test ensures the PRP extraction process will be effective and that your body is ready to respond positively to the regenerative therapy. Based on the results, the doctor may provide instructions or timelines tailored to your body’s readiness for the procedure.


Hydration: Essential Pre-Treatment Step

Hydration is more than just a general health tip—it’s a specific requirement before your treatment. To extract a sufficient amount of high-quality plasma, your blood volume must be at an optimal level. Staying well-hydrated 24 to 48 hours before the appointment enhances the efficiency of blood draw and ensures the platelet concentration is high enough to stimulate regenerative effects.

Doctors often recommend:

  • Drinking at least 8–10 glasses of water the day before the treatment.

  • Avoiding caffeine and alcohol, which can dehydrate the body.

  • Eating a light, nutritious meal on the morning of the procedure.

Proper hydration directly supports the quality of the PRP and the effectiveness of the therapy.


Avoid Certain Substances Before Treatment

Prior to receiving P Shot Treatment, doctors advise avoiding substances that may affect platelet function or blood consistency. These include:

  • Smoking, as it restricts blood flow and impairs healing.

  • Over-the-counter anti-inflammatory medications (as advised by the doctor).

  • Excessive alcohol consumption.

While these may seem like minor lifestyle choices, they can impact your body’s ability to respond optimally to the treatment. A clean, healthy system allows the PRP to work more effectively, promoting long-term improvement and satisfaction with the results.

The Day of the Procedure: What to Expect

On the treatment day, you’ll be welcomed into a comfortable clinical setting where a certified doctor or medical professional will oversee the entire procedure. The process is straightforward, and preparation on your part is minimal if you’ve followed the pre-treatment instructions.

Here’s what generally happens:

  1. Blood is drawn and processed in a centrifuge to isolate the platelet-rich plasma.

  2. The PRP is then prepared for injection under sterile conditions.

  3. The doctor administers the treatment using precision techniques.

Since the treatment is done using your own biological material, there’s minimal risk, and the recovery process is often simple and quick.
